The Oakwood Board of Education discussed the district office relocation from the Rubicon House citing health, structural and ADA concerns; the board had approved a seven‑year lease at Sugar Camp at its Nov. 10 meeting and staff expect to transition in spring.

The Oakwood Board of Education heard a superintendent report on December 8 explaining why the district is moving central office operations out of the historic Rubicon House.

The superintendent said the district temporarily relocated staff roughly three months earlier in response to “immediate health and safety concerns” and longstanding structural problems at 20 Rubicon Road, including basement support issues and limitations that make the building not ADA-compliant.
